Furfural [2-Furancarboxaldehyde] is a naturally occurring compound, present in some essential oils and in foods such as bread, baked products, and coffee.
It is prepared industrially by treatment with hot sulfuric acid of pentosans contained in agricultural residues, such as cereal straw, bran, and sugarcane bagasse.
Furfural is a new pesticide active ingredient intended for the use as a fumigant to control root infesting plant parasitic nematodes and fungal plant diseases .
The technical formulation (Furfural Technical) contains 99.7% furfural and is for the use in formulating end-use products and is applied to growing media and/or soils in greenhouses and field.
